Storm quickly took the throne as the strongest character in the game Marvel Rivals Season 1. A recent round of buffs has transformed her from one of the least powerful damage dealers to a threat at all skill levels in the hero shooter’s ranked mode.
According to a stats tracking website RivalsMetawhich pulls data from the game’s resilient API, has the highest win rate of all 35 champions, at around 57%. She had just 51% last season and was generally considered one of the weakest duelists compared to popular picks like Hela, Hawkeye, and Psylocke. However, a slight buff to her damage output and survivability during Hurricane Ultimate tipped the scales.
It’s not just that she can rule the skies without having to land, but the damage boost she provides to the entire team makes her extremely powerful. Storm is a support character disguised as a damage dealer who turns any team she is on into a sharpened knife. And since actual support champions with their own damage buffs like Mantis are already extremely popular, teams with both champions are unstoppable.
In the highest rankings, Storm’s presence has increased the win rate of champions who benefit from her the most, such as Magik and Wolverine. They both need to get close to their enemies to do anything, and the damage boost makes it much easier for them to get in and out unscathed – much to the chagrin of every support player. Even heroes like Black Widow, who had difficulty killing characters that survived her sniper shots, are starting to climb from the bottom of the tier lists.
This way, a handful of buffs can change the shape of the meta, even if they don’t look like much. No one is calling for a nerf for Storm yet, but I suspect demand will grow as more players understand the impact of the hard-to-find flying champion on team-wide benefits.
